Transaction ef006ab99d4e6f98286fe758ba2b21c1e568072a407dc44f0e387a71b22da86e

1 Input
1 Outputs
  • ef006ab99d4e6f98286fe758ba2b21c1e568072a407dc44f0e387a71b22da86e:0
  • value  35637981
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G